Towards A Refined Maturity: Etiquettes of Disagreement

by Hamza Yusuf & Shaykh Bin Bayyah

 

One of the greatest problems confronting modern Muslims is our inability to tolerate each other, let alone others. Our tradition has a rich science known as “the courtesies of differences and the etiquette of discussion.” In this edifying talk, The Etiquette of Disagreement, one of the greatest scholars today, Shaykh Abdallah bin Bayyah, illuminates the essential aspects of this subject.

All Muslims who plan to engage in any conversation should listen to this talk over and over again until its meanings are internalized and they understand that the secret of interlocution is a desire to know and not a desire to conquor. Only when we sublimate our egos and have a desire to engage in genuine dialogue with others do we achieve a spiritual status of what the English refer to as “the gentleman” and what the Arabs call al-adib – “the gentle one.”
